Let's talk about footwear because honestly, this is where I see most amateur athletes making costly mistakes. The right basketball shoes need to provide ankle support without restricting movement, offer cushioning that absorbs impact up to 3 times body weight during jumps, and maintain grip through rapid directional changes. Watching the SAN Miguel players pivot and cut during their game-winning performance reminded me of how crucial footwork is in basketball. I've probably owned over 40 pairs of basketball shoes throughout my playing and coaching career, and I've learned that spending an extra $50-100 on proper footwear can prevent injuries that might cost you months of recovery. My personal favorite right now are shoes with adaptive cushioning technology - the kind that actually responds to your movement patterns. They're worth every penny when you consider how much they reduce joint stress during those hard landings.

The evolution of sports fabric technology has been remarkable to witness. We've moved from basic synthetic blends to smart textiles that can regulate body temperature, reduce muscle vibration, and even monitor biometric data. While the average consumer might not need all the bells and whistles, understanding the basic technology can help make smarter purchasing decisions. I typically recommend that serious athletes allocate about 15-20% of their training budget to quality apparel - it's that important. The return on investment comes not just in immediate performance enhancement but in long-term joint health and injury prevention.
